ENJOY THIS SNIPPET:

She pointed toward his foot, "Are you all right?"
"I can play with it."
Doug reached out toward her and she recoiled, giving him a strained look. He quickly held up his hands, "Sorry, I thought you might have another bottle for me."
"Don't touch me." Her voice was low, almost harsh. A sudden breeze blew past Joe. Though Rachel never said, he noticed that when Rachel grew upset, the wind tended to blow, its intensity a reflection of her mood.
Doug frowned and turned to watch the game.

YOUNG WITCHCRAFT: 
BLURB:  
Rachel's secret would have Cotton Mather rolling over in his grave. She's been raised from an early age to use magic for good, despite her temptation to cast a spell against Phil the bully who can't stop teasing her. 

Joe thinks Rachel is cool, especially when she weaves her healing magic spells on him, but he's got his own problems. It's not easy keeping Rachel safe from Phil's constant threats.

When Phil poisons Rachel, can love and little young witchcraft bring Rachel and Joe together or have years of Phil's bullying ruined their relationship for good?
